About D. Rex Hamilton
D. Rex Hamilton is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Ophthalmology, Epidemiology, Surgery and Neurology, having authored 24 papers that have together received 527 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Corneal surgery and disorders (14 papers), Ophthalmology and Visual Impairment Studies (4 papers), Intraocular Surgery and Lenses (4 papers),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(2 papers), Glaucoma and retinal disorders (2 papers), Organ and Tissue Transplantation Research (1 paper),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(1 paper) and MRI in cancer diagnosis (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(133 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(344 citations), Epidemiology (119 citations), Transplantation (6 citations) and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(60 citations). D. Rex Hamilton has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Hungary and Türkiye. Frequent co-authors include David R. Hardten, Robert K. Maloney, Edward E. Manche, Larry F. Rich, Barış Sönmez, Myhanh Nguyen, Richard D. Johnson, Nancy Lee, Jonathan M. Davidorf and Robert B. Lufkin.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Cataract & Refractive Surgery, Cornea, Journal of Refractive Surgery, Ophthalmology and Otolaryngologic Clinics of North America.
